PaperCut Printing for Chromebooks

Overview

Our upgraded copiers now support PaperCut Hive, providing enhanced convenience, security, and accessibility compared to traditional printing methods.

  • Print jobs are stored securely in the cloud for up to 24 hours.
  • Retrieve prints from any Konica Minolta copier at Giles or Leigh—no need to choose a specific printer in advance.
  • Reduces misprints and enhances privacy—no more abandoned or misdirected documents.
  • Supports remote printing from home, Giles, Leigh, or anywhere with an internet connection.

Note: PaperCut only works with our Konica Minolta devices. Other printers will continue to function as they have in the past.

Getting Started

Once your account is created, you'll receive an email from PaperCut. When looking at this email Chromebook users should:

  1. Ignore the “Get Started” button (it’s for Mac and Windows).
  2. Scroll down and note your unique PaperCut Access Code.
  3. This code is required to print, copy, scan to email, or scan to Google Drive. It cannot be changed but can be retrieved later from any Konica Minolta panel.

How to Start a Print Job

  1. Open the document you wish to print.
  2. Select Print → See More… → PaperCut Printer.
  3. If prompted, enter your school email.
  4. Click “Continue with Google” and accept PaperCut Hive terms.

  5. Note: You must be logged into PaperCut Hive to print.
    You may sign in at login.papercut.com if you are not prompted or want to verify login in advance of printing.

Releasing Your Print Jobs

  1. Go to any Konica Minolta copier.
  2. Enter your PaperCut code at the login screen.
  3. Select Print Release.
  4. Choose print jobs to release or delete.

  5. Note: Jobs expire after 24 hours if not printed.

How to Scan

  1. Select Quick Scan.
  2. Load your document into the automatic feeder.
  3. Choose either Scan to Google Drive or Scan to Email.
  4. Follow the on screen instructions.

How to Make Copies

  1. Tap Device Functions.
  2. Select Copy.
  3. Copy functions should be almost exactly the same as they were on the previous units.
  4. To return to PaperCut, tap Home and then PaperCut.

Logging Out

  • Tap the door icon next to your email address on the PaperCut screen.
  • Use the door icon in the bottom row of the copy screen.
  • PaperCut will automatically log you out after 3 minutes of inactivity.
